What Can I Do For A Dog With Hip Dysplasia. hip dysplasia is a common inherited disease in dogs. It can be very painful and can cause other conditions, such as arthritis. applied heat, massage, good bedding, exercise and weight management as well as nutrition and physiotherapy also play a part in caring for a dog affected by hip dysplasia. Talk to your vet if you notice any signs of hip dysplasia. Your dog's results can then be sent to the bva/kc hip dysplasia scheme for grading.
